arched window repair frames should be inspected regularly for signs of damage or rot. They may be damaged by moisture or wood-eating fungus, and they can start to sag when the wood is decaying inside. This could allow water to leak into the house and cause further damage. Window specialists repair damaged frames or sashes, and add weather stripping to prevent drafts. They can also replace the caulking on your window and rehang it to increase its energy efficiency.

Condensation between condo window repair panes is another common issue. This could indicate that the seal between the window panes has broken or the structural solidity of the double-paned windows is compromised. Window experts can repair damaged seals and clean the glass to restore the window’s function. This will lower your energy costs.

Safety

Window doctors take safety measures to ensure that their clients can escape through a house's windows in case emergencies arise, such as carbon monoxide poisoning or a fire. If they are installing windows or repair old ones, these professionals make sure that all windows are safe to open and close as required. They also ensure that moving parts are well-lubricated to avoid rust and stiffness, which can make it difficult for a window to open or close.

window hardware repair guards bars, security grilles, or security grilles that block windows are commonly used by some homeowners, but they are ineffective during an emergency. Instead, they should install ASTM F2090 compliant devices that limit the amount of time a window will open or windows with quick-release mechanisms that allow windows to be opened even if the house is locked. They should also teach their children about window safety and draw up an escape plan that specifies which windows that they can escape through during an emergency.
